Travelcards and tickets

Under 20 years of age = youth ticket

If you have no right to free school transport and are younger than 20, the 30-day ticket for children and youth be an excellent alternative. You can also buy the 7-day ticket at youth price.

20 - 30 years of age = student ticket

Full-time students and apprentices between 20 and 30 years of age can on certain conditions buy 30-day ticket with student discount. You must among other things be under 30 and study full time for a minimum of 3 months at a campus in Oslo or Akershus. If you are older than 30, you must buy an ordinary adult ticket.

NOTE: When you travel with a discount ticket (youth or student ticket), you must be able to show identification when the conductor asks for it. When using a student discount ticket, you must be able to show student ID with confirmation of paid tuition fee or an apprenticeship contract. Read more about discounts.

Getting hold of travelcards and tickets

You can buy a travelcard with a youth or student ticket at all Ruter’s points of sale. If you already have a travelcard, you can also buy a ticket from ticket machines. See all ticket sales outlets.

Using the travelcard

The first time you travel with a new ticket you must activate (validate) your ticket by having a validator scan the travelcard. Activation may be compared to stamping a paper ticket. Read more about the travelcard, its use and registration.
